    Sliding door tracks can become misaligned and stop the doors from opening and closing properly. In certain cases the track may be bent outward or inward and requires a skilled professional to repair. The bent tracks can also cause doors to jump when they are closed and opened. In either case, a track can be fixed by using vise grips or pliers to straighten it out. A new track can be caulked or screwed to be fixed.

    Fogging is a different issue with sliding glass door. Condensation between the insulated layers of glass results in foggy glass. This happens when the seals start to fail and moisture starts to leak through the layers. Foggy glass does not just affect the appearance of your sliding door, but it can also result in energy loss in your home.

    A foggy door glass is an excuse to contact an expert. A skilled glazier can replace insulated window glass in a fairly simple manner which will save you money on cooling and heating costs.

    Sticky Tracks

    Sliding glass doors are a fantastic method to open the space to a stunning view and maximize space utilization. These wonderful home features can be a source of issues. They include sticky sliding tracks for doors, which can make it difficult for you to move the doors. They also can affect your home's safety and security.

    Start by taking the track off tilt and slide patio door repairs near me then cleaning it. Have a friend help you remove the door if unable to do so. You can then remove or pry off the covers of the adjustment screw on the opposite side of the track. Standing on the side of the door, ask your assistant to slowly move the top edge toward you to clear the track and adjust the height.

    Then, clean the track with hot soapy water and a toothbrush and dry it. After cleaning the track, apply a thin layer of lubricant to both the top and the bottom tracks. It is a good idea to add a little bit to the area where the latches attach to give you extra security.

    A sagging or misaligned track can also cause your patio door to fail. This is a common problem that can be caused by dirt and debris that have accumulated over time. You will need to thoroughly clean the rollers and tracks to resolve this issue. Then, you can lubricate them by using a silicone-based lubricant to enable them to move smoothly again.
